Export Control and Sanctions, MEA Zone Leader

The Export Control and Sanctions Zone Leader is responsible for leading and implementing Schneider Electric's export control and sanctions compliance program within the assigned Zone.

The role ensures effective deployment of required processes and controls at the cluster and country level, provides expert regulatory guidance, and partners closely with Zone leadership and business stakeholders.

This position reports directly to the Vice President, Export Control and Sanctions, and works in close coordination with other Zone Leaders and the Global Program Leader to ensure consistent application of the Group's compliance framework.

Key Responsibilities:

Program Implementation & Oversight


* Lead the implementation and execution of Schneider Electric's export control and sanctions compliance program across the Zone.


* Monitor applicable export control and sanctions regulations, assess regulatory changes, and ensure timely communication and integration into Zone processes.


* Develop a strong understanding of Zone business models and operational processes to effectively embed compliance requirements.


* Serve as a trusted advisor to Zone leadership and business stakeholders on export control and sanctions matters.

Leadership & People Management


* Manage and develop a team responsible for Zone-level export control and sanctions activities, including transaction reviews and escalations.


* Foster technical expertise and regulatory awareness within the team through coaching, guidance, and capability development.


* Promote a strong culture of compliance, accountability, and continuous improvement across the Zone.

Risk Management & Escalations


* Manage escalations related to export control clauses and compliance risks.


* Act as the primary point of contact for export control and sanctions matters with relevant government authorities at the Zone level.


* Support and/or lead compliance reviews and audits at Schneider Electric entities and oversee implementation of resulting corrective and improvement actions.

Training & Awareness


* In coordination with the Export Control and Sanctions Program, deliver regular training for Zone employees at all levels.


* Provide targeted training and regulatory updates to employees with export control and sanctions responsibilities (e.g., Sales, Logistics, Finance).

Coordination & Cross-Functional Collaboration


* Partner closely with Zone Legal teams on contractual, regulatory, and compliance-related matters.


* Support export control classification questions and escalations, coordinating with the Export Control Classification Team as required.


* Support screening questions and escalations, coordinating with the Export Control and Sanctions Screening Team as required.


* Validate export control testing and assessments for Zone entities in coordination with the global Program team and support development of action plans where needed.
